As well as Duncan Poyser, hotel manager Sonia Banks also had a very eerie experience at Flitwick.
As with Duncan, she was alone at the hotel and had opted to stay overnight.
After locking up, Sonia went up to room eight for the night and began to get ready for bed.
As she was getting changed, the silence of Flitik was broken by the sound of very loud footsteps.
But these weren't coming from the corridor outside her room.
These were coming from the floor above.
Sonja continued to listen and heard the footsteps stop.
Then a door being slammed.
Whoever or whatever was making those noises, it was in the same location as the room which has been recently rediscovered.
The housekeeper's alleged room.
Sonja admitted that she was quite shocked by this incident, mainly because she knew she was the only person in the hotel that night.
It wasn't an easy or comfortable night's sleep, but the most frightening experience for a member of staff was still to come.
